Observation of the Birds on Mariana Islands

From Habele Institute

Kobayashi, Keisuke (1970). "Observation of the Birds on Mariana Islands". Japanese Journal of Ornithology. 20 (88): 24–29. doi:10.3838/jjo1915.20.24. ISSN 0040-9480.


Abstract: I made a short trip to Guam and Saipan from 27th April to 1st May 1970. Of the 18 species observed, the record of Charadrius leschnaultii from Saipan is apparently new for the island. Passer montanus and Lonchura malacca are lack in the list of Baker's "The Air-fauna of Micronesia" (1951) but King (1962) observed both species abundant on Guam when he visited there in 1960. They are considered to be introduced to Guam between 1951 and 1960. King failed to observe Dicururus macrocercus on Guam in 1960. But Tubb (1966) observed several individuals towards the north end of the island in 1965. Apparently this species was introduced to Guam between 1960 and 1965. I noticed it is common in central Guam, expanding it's distribution toward south of the island. The annoted list of the whole 18 species is as below.
